Thank you for purchasing the Self Charge Auto Jumper by Wagan Tech.
With normal care and proper treatment it will provide years of reliable
service. Please read all operating instructions carefully before use.
Do not use the Self Charge Auto Jumper with a completely discharged
battery
Charging a Weak Battery:
• Be sure the Self Charge Auto Jumper is not connected to the
vehicle before attempting to start vehicle.
• Turn off lights and all other electrical accessories (e.g. fan, radio,
windshield wipers, etc.) Turn on the small interior light to use as
an indicator that the battery is charging.
• If you have a car alarm, the car alarm must be put into "Valet
Mode". Many popular car alarms will cut off power to the vehicles
electrical system. If you have this type of alarm, the Self Charge
Auto Jumper will not work if the alarm is engaged.
• Make sure your cigarette lighter socket is clean and free of debris.
• Plug the Self Charge Auto Jumper into the cigarette lighter socket.
• Push the "On/Off" button to the "On" Position.
• The light on the 12-volt cigarette connector will illuminate to show
charging has begun. The interior light will also illuminate.
• If the light or dial does not brighten, turn on the ignition key to the
"Accessories" position (see vehicle owner's manual). If your
vehicle's 12-volt cigarette lighter or power source is off when the
ignition is off, be sure the ignition key is set to the "Accessories"
position during the recharging process.
• If the interior light does not brighten, turn off the interior light.
Allow the unit to remain in the cigarette lighter for at least 35
minutes.
• Attempt to start the vehicle. If the vehicle does not start, DO NOT
attempt to start the engine more than twice. Call a service center or
tow truck.
Recharging the Self Charge Auto Jumper:
• To recharge the Self Charge Auto Jumper through the vehicle, push the
"On/Off" button to the "Off" position, and simply leave the Self Charge
Auto Jumper plugged into the cigarette lighter socket for 30 to 60 minutes
while the engine is running. This will provide enough charge for future
use.
• Do not leave the Self Charge Auto Jumper plugged into the vehicle
cigarette lighter socket when the vehicle is not running. This will not
cause any damage to your vehicle battery, but may discharge the Self
Charge Auto Jumper.
Using the Self Charge Auto Jumper as a 12-volt DC Power
Source:
• The Self Charge Auto Jumper comes equipped with a 12-volt DC power
socket.
• The socket of the Self Charge Auto Jumper has a positive (+) center pin.
Most, but not all, 12-volt DC accessories come with this configuration.
• Before connecting any 12-volt DC accessory to the Self Charge Auto
Jumper, Check the polarity of the accessory (see accessory owners
manual).
• For DC accessories that do not have a positive (+) center pin, do not
operate at 12 volts, or have a different connector, you must use a DC-to-
DC adopter (sold separately).
• The Self Charge Auto Jumper is designed to operate a number of DC
accessories successfully: 12-volt radios, cellular phones, PDAs, etc.
• A DC-to-DC adapter set is required to run these accessory items and is
available at most discount department stores.
Storage and Precautions:
• The Self Charge Auto Jumper is NOT waterproof!
• It will be damaged if submerged in water.
• When not in use, the Self Charge Auto Jumper should only be stored in
an environment temperature of 32 F to 110 F.
• During operation, the Self Charge Auto Jumper may become warm.
• Discontinue operation if the Self Charge Auto Jumper becomes too hot.
• Please be responsible: always recycle your Ni-Cad! ®

Important Points:
• The Self Charge Auto Jumper comes fully charged. However, it is
recommended that you initially charge the unit overnight using
your AC Adapter or by your cigarette lighter for at least 30
minutes.
• The Self Charge Auto Jumper includes fuse protection that
regulates the discharge and recharge of the Self Charge Auto
Jumper.
• Self Charge Auto Jumper is designed to recharge 12-volt batteries
with a low voltage between 10.4 and 10.5 Volts.
• The Self Charge Auto Jumper should be charged every 12 months
regardless of usage. Using an AC adapter is recommended.
Technical Information:
• Power 19.8 Watts - Battery Type: Sub-C Ni-Cad
• Battery Size: 1500mAh - Voltage Output: 13.2V DC
• Fuse Size: 20A
Annual Recharging:
• Regardless of use, the Self Charge Auto Jumper Ni-Cad Battery
System must be recharged at least once during every 12-month
period.
Recharging Time:
• 10 - 20 Minutes: Should charge most weak batteries of most
vehicles.
• Recharge Self Charge Auto Jumper from battery. Charge for 30 -
60 minutes with engine or motor running.
• AC adapter charges in 4-6 hours.
• Lifetime Recharging Cycle: Most Ni-Cad batteries average over
500 charges per unit, (Many can be used up to 750 times
depending on care and maintenance).
DC Devices Hours and Specialties
Cellular Phone 4 hours of Talk, 5 days of Stand by
Camcorder 3 Hours (0.6A Load), 4.5 Hours (0.4A Load)
Flashlight 20 Minutes
Laptop 25 watt bulbs, 1 hour, 12.5 watt bulbs, about 2 hours
DC-to-DC is required for most electrical accessories.
